WebBachelor’s Degree that includes required 10 courses. Child Life Experience: Complete a minimum of 600 hours of a child life clinical experience under the direct supervision of a Certified Child Life Specialist. Volunteer, practicum and paid work hours are not accepted. WebMar 16, 2024 · Child Life Specialist Education Requirements.
